Morning all! Not much to report, Loop still Looping, have had to set an a increased temporary override for those few days. Didn’t want to launch straight into a 200% or anything so have been gradually increasing it over the last 24 hours. Currently at 150% (basal, corrections and bolus) and seem to be ticking along nicely this morning. Just awaiting a work phone call, or not, as the case may be.
